Understanding Betamethasone Dipropionate and Its Uses
Betamethasone dipropionate is a potent topical corticosteroid widely prescribed for treating inflammatory skin conditions such as eczema, psoriasis, and dermatitis. Its primary function is to reduce redness, swelling, and itching by suppressing the immune response in affected areas. This medication comes in various forms including creams, ointments, lotions, and gels, making it versatile for different skin types and conditions.
The strength of betamethasone dipropionate means it should be used cautiously and under medical supervision. Overuse or misuse can lead to several side effects, some of which might affect hair follicles. Understanding its mechanism helps clarify why hair loss concerns arise with this medication.
How Betamethasone Dipropionate Works on the Skin
Corticosteroids like betamethasone dipropionate work by mimicking cortisol, a hormone naturally produced by the adrenal glands. When applied topically, it penetrates the skin layers to suppress inflammation by inhibiting the release of inflammatory chemicals such as prostaglandins and leukotrienes.
This anti-inflammatory effect calms irritated skin but also impacts the skin’s natural repair processes. Prolonged steroid use can thin the skin by breaking down collagen and reducing cell regeneration. Since hair follicles reside within the skin’s dermal layer, any changes to skin structure or blood supply can influence hair growth cycles.
The Connection Between Corticosteroids and Hair Follicles
Hair follicles are complex mini-organs responsible for producing hair shafts. Their activity depends on a delicate balance of hormones, blood flow, and cellular health. Corticosteroids may disrupt this balance by:
- Reducing inflammation around follicles
- Altering local immune responses
- Thinning the skin that supports follicles
- Potentially affecting blood circulation near follicles
While these effects can benefit inflammatory scalp conditions causing hair shedding, excessive or prolonged steroid application can paradoxically cause follicle damage or telogen effluvium—a form of temporary hair loss triggered by stress on the follicles.
Does Betamethasone Dipropionate Cause Hair Loss? Examining the Evidence
Reports of hair loss directly attributed to betamethasone dipropionate are uncommon but documented in medical literature. Most cases involve:
- Long-term use beyond prescribed duration
- Application on the scalp or hairy regions with high potency formulas
- Use without breaks or alternating with non-steroidal treatments
- Underlying scalp infections aggravated by steroid use
Hair loss from topical steroids generally manifests as diffuse thinning rather than patchy bald spots. This is because corticosteroids can push hair follicles prematurely into the resting (telogen) phase of their cycle, causing hairs to shed en masse after a few weeks.

The Role of Application Site and Duration in Hair Loss Risk
The location where betamethasone dipropionate is applied plays a crucial role in whether hair loss might occur. The scalp has a dense population of hair follicles and thinner skin compared to other body parts. Applying potent steroids here increases absorption rates and potential side effects.
Prolonged application without breaks leads to cumulative suppression of follicular function. The skin becomes thinner, blood flow may reduce slightly, and follicles can enter a dormant phase prematurely. This combination creates an environment where shedding happens more readily.
In contrast, short-term use on non-hairy areas typically does not impact hair growth significantly due to lower absorption and less follicle density.
Dosing Guidelines to Minimize Hair Loss Risk
Physicians often recommend:
- Using the lowest effective potency for the shortest time possible.
- Avoiding continuous daily application longer than two to four weeks.
- Cycling treatment with drug-free intervals.
- Avoiding occlusive dressings unless directed by a doctor.
- Monitoring for signs of skin thinning or irritation.
These measures help maintain therapeutic benefits while protecting hair follicle health.
The Biological Mechanism Behind Steroid-Induced Hair Shedding
Hair growth occurs in three phases: anagen (growth), catagen (transitional), and telogen (resting). Corticosteroids influence these phases by:
- Anagen Suppression: Steroids may inhibit mitotic activity in follicular cells during anagen, slowing growth.
- Telogen Induction: They can trigger premature transition into telogen phase, leading to shedding after about two months.
- Follicular Miniaturization: Long-term exposure might cause follicles to shrink temporarily, producing thinner hairs.
- Immune Modulation: By dampening inflammation around follicles, steroids help some inflammatory alopecias but may also disrupt normal immune signals essential for follicle cycling.
This complex interplay explains why steroids sometimes help with inflammatory hair loss but can cause shedding if misused.
Comparing Betamethasone Dipropionate with Other Topical Steroids on Hair Loss Potential
Not all topical steroids carry the same risk for hair loss. Potency, formulation, and site of application influence outcomes substantially.
| Steroid Type | Potency Level | Hair Loss Risk Profile |
|---|---|---|
| Betamethasone Dipropionate | High potency (Class I) | Moderate risk if overused on scalp; reversible shedding common. |
| Hydrocortisone Creams | Mild potency (Class VII) | Low risk; generally safe for long-term use on scalp with minimal side effects. |
| Mometasone Furoate | Medium potency (Class III-IV) | Slight risk; safer alternative for sensitive areas but still requires monitoring. |
| Clobetasol Propionate | Ultra-high potency (Class I) | Higher risk for skin thinning and hair loss; reserved for severe cases only. |
Choosing the right steroid depends on balancing efficacy against possible side effects like hair thinning or shedding.

The Long-Term Outlook: Can Hair Regrow After Steroid-Induced Loss?
Most steroid-related hair loss is temporary and reversible once treatment stops or is modified properly. Follicles usually recover normal cycling within several months as inflammation reduces and skin regains thickness.
However, chronic misuse or very high doses might cause lasting damage due to scarring or permanent follicular atrophy—though this is extremely rare when used as directed.
Patience is key because regrowth follows natural cycles that take time—often between three to six months before noticeable improvement occurs.
